Description
Enjoy a delicious Air Fryer Chicken Parmesan that’s perfect for an easy dinner or a quick weeknight dinner. This family dinner features crispy breaded chicken cutlets topped with melted cheese and marinara sauce.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 boneless skinless chicken breasts
- Kosher salt
- Freshly ground black pepper
- 1/3 cup all-purpose flour
- 2 large eggs
- 1 cup panko bread crumbs
- 1/4 cup finely grated Parmesan
- 1 tsp dried oregano
- 1/2 tsp crushed red pepper flakes
- 1/2 tsp garlic powder
- 1 cup store-bought or homemade marinara sauce
- 1 cup shredded mozzarella
- Chopped fresh parsley for serving
Instructions
- Cut the chicken breasts horizontally to make four thin pieces and season both sides with salt and pepper.
- Season the flour with salt and pepper in a bowl, beat the eggs in a second bowl, and mix panko bread crumbs with Parmesan, oregano, red pepper flakes, and garlic powder in a third bowl.
- Coat each chicken piece first in flour, shaking off extras, then dip into eggs removing excess, and finally press into the panko mixture ensuring full coverage.
- Arrange the chicken in a single layer inside the air fryer basket and cook at 400 degrees Fahrenheit for about 5 minutes on each side until cooked through.
- Add marinara sauce and mozzarella on top of the chicken and continue cooking at 400 degrees for about 3 more minutes until the cheese melts and turns golden.
- Cook Time: 13 minutes
- Method: Air Fryer
